Investigation Summary

Investigation Nr: 14552475
Event: 08/14/1985
RUN OVER BY BACKHOE

ON AUGUST 14, 1985 AT APPROXIMATELY 8 AM, EMPLOYEE #1 WAS RIDING ON THE SIDE STEP OF A BACKHOE. THE MACHINE WAS BACKING UP. EMPLOYEE #1 LOST HIS FOOTING AND/OR GRIP AND FELL TO THE GROUND. THE LEFT FRONT WHEEL PASSED OVER HIS CHEST. EMPLOYEE #1 SUFFERED ABRASIONS ON HIS CHEST AND HAD HIS SPLEEN REMOVED.
